62Dimensions are nominal and subject to the tolerances in the standard.{{r|iso8362_1}} Two consequences follow for reading a label. A vial described as a 2 mL vial holds about 4 mL brimful, so a 2R vial containing 1 mL of liquid looks nearly empty and a 2R vial containing a 5 mg lyophilised cake may appear to contain nothing at all. And the neck finish, not the nominal capacity, determines which closure fits — 13 mm and 20 mm are not interchangeable, and a 20 mm stopper on a 13 mm vial cannot be sealed.62Dimensions are nominal and subject to the tolerances in the standard.{{r|iso8362_1}} Two consequences follow for reading a label. +64The label declaration for an injectable is the volume or mass withdrawable, and vials are therefore filled with a small excess. USP <697> requires that the volume obtainable be not less than the labelled volume, and USP <1151> gives recommended excess volumes for that purpose.

64== Elastomeric closures ==66== Elastomeric closures ==
65The stopper performs three functions: it seals, it is penetrable by a needle and reseals afterwards, and it must not contribute leachables to the product. No single elastomer optimises all three, and formulation is a compromise.67The stopper performs three functions: it seals, it is penetrable by a needle and reseals afterwards, and it must not contribute leachables to the product.
